Early Career and Content Strategy
Wengie started by posting short, energetic videos that quickly captured attention. Her focus on fast cuts, bright visuals, and relatable humor helped her stand out on YouTube.
By consistently uploading comedy sketches, lifestyle clips, and collaboration videos, she built a loyal viewer base that engaged through comments and shares. Early partnerships with other creators expanded her reach into new audiences.
Music Releases and Digital Sales
Wengie launched her music career with catchy pop tracks designed for streaming platforms. Singles such as "Spray" and "Fashionista" performed well on digital charts and playlists.
Each release drove additional streams, increased her visibility, and created another revenue channel through digital downloads and performance royalties. Music videos on her main channel also boosted overall watch time.
